Dvi-I Single Link. Can support resolutions up to 1920 x 1080 at 60 hz. Single link dvi supports a maximum bandwidth of 165 mhz (1920 x 1080 at 60 hz, 1280 x 1024 at 85 hz) and utilizes 12 of the 24 available pins.
